Mandatory Annual Public Review of Federal Government Financial Health.
This Act mandates an annual, public joint hearing where the Comptroller General (GAO) must present an objective analysis of the audited federal government financial statements. Citizens gain greater transparency into the nation's true financial condition, including deficits, surpluses, and long-term fiscal sustainability projections, enhancing executive branch accountability. The hearing is open to the public and media.
Key points
Requires the Comptroller General (GAO) to publicly present an audit review of the federal government's finances, including long-term sustainability projections.
The hearing must occur within 45 business days of the financial statement submission and must be open to the public and media coverage.
All members of Congress are permitted to participate in the joint hearing, regardless of their membership on the Budget Committees.
